Game data

Configuration file(s) location

System Location
Windows %USERPROFILE%\Saved Games\Primordia\acsetup.cfg
macOS (OS X)
Linux $XDG_DATA_HOME/ags/Primordia/acsetup.cfg
This game follows the XDG Base Directory Specification on Linux.

Save game data location

System Location
Windows %USERPROFILE%\Saved Games\Primordia\
macOS (OS X) $HOME/Library/Application Support/Primordia/
Linux $XDG_DATA_HOME/ags/Primordia/agssave.*

Video

Graphics options accessed through <path-to-game>\winsetup.exe.
Graphics options accessed through <path-to-game>\winsetup.exe.
In-game settings.
In-game settings.

Graphics feature State Notes
Widescreen resolution
Pixel-perfect, static aspect, or stretched 320x200 (16:10). Scaling algorithm is either nearest-neighbor or bilinear.
Multi-monitor
Ultra-widescreen
4K Ultra HD
Resolution can be set, but either pillarboxed or stretched.
Field of view (FOV)
Windowed
Borderless fullscreen windowed
See the glossary page for potential workarounds.
Anisotropic filtering (AF)
Anti-aliasing (AA)
Since the game is rendered with low-resolution pixel art, traditional anti-aliasing is impossible. The game does support sprite scaling, however.
Vertical sync (Vsync)
60 FPS and 120+ FPS
Frame rate is locked to 40 FPS.
